Sports Market Analysis: Dominant Favorite Control Pattern Spotlight

The Western Illinois vs Wisconsin market analysis Sep 12 exemplifies what we call the Dominant Favorite Control pattern — a game where the favorite's game signal is so compressed near 100% that traditional technical analysis tools lose their practical utility.

Definition: Dominant Favorite Control occurs when a team opens above 98% game signal and never drops below 99% throughout the contest. RSI may oscillate dramatically (as it did here, from 11.4 to 99.8), but the underlying price action is essentially flat. This pattern is most common in college football and college basketball when Power Five programs host FCS or lower-division opponents.

This market analysis pattern is important to recognize because it can generate false signals that appear tradeable on the RSI chart but are structurally impossible to execute profitably. The Western Illinois vs Wisconsin market analysis Sep 12 is a case study in signal noise versus tradeable signal.

How to Identify:

  • Opening game signal above 98% for the favorite
  • Spread exceeding 35 points (college football) or 25 points (college basketball)
  • No lead changes throughout the game
  • RSI oscillations that don't correspond to meaningful game signal movement (>2% swing)
  • Game signal range of less than 2% across the entire contest

Trading Logic:

  • Avoid entry: When the game signal is above 98%, there is no practical long entry on the favorite (insufficient upside) and no realistic long entry on the underdog (insufficient probability of reversal)
  • Pattern recognition value: Identifying this pattern pre-game saves capital — don't allocate to games where the spread exceeds your minimum volatility threshold
  • RSI context matters: An RSI of 11.4 in a blowout is NOT the same as an RSI of 11.4 in a competitive game — always contextualize momentum indicators against the game signal level
  • Risk management: The minimum profit threshold (10%) exists precisely to filter out these compressed-market situations

Historical Context: In college football, games with spreads exceeding 40 points produce tradeable windows (meeting 10%+ return thresholds) less than 15% of the time. The structural mismatch between programs is priced into the opening game signal, and the market rarely deviates enough to create systematic opportunities. This Western Illinois vs Wisconsin market analysis Sep 12 is a textbook example of why spread size is the first filter in any systematic sports market analysis framework — before RSI, before MACD, before divergence signals, the spread tells you whether a game is worth analyzing at all.

The pattern also highlights an important distinction in sports market analysis: RSI measures momentum relative to recent price action, not absolute price levels. In a game where the price is locked between $0.992 and $1.000, even a dramatic RSI swing from 98 to 11.4 represents a momentum shift within a fraction of a percentage point of game signal movement. Traders who focus exclusively on RSI without contextualizing it against the game signal level will find themselves identifying "signals" in markets that offer no practical trading opportunity.
